The time-resolved dynamic light scattering has been employed to investigate gelation of divinylbenzene (DVB; branched chains) and vitrification of styrene (St; linear chains) during radical polymerization in bulk. The intensity correlation function (ICF) was obtained every 30s during polymerization process. The DVB system exhibited a power law behavior in ICF characteristic of gelation threshold, which was followed by vitrification. In the case of St, two relaxation modes appeared before vitrification, which were assigned to be the cooperative and the slow relaxation modes. (c) 2005 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
